Northern Knights vs Canterbury Kings Eliminator T20 Prediction, Dream11 And Analysis

The league stage is over, and now it’s time for the Super Smash 2024-25 Eliminator Final. Northern Brave will face a tough challenge as they take on the Canterbury Kings at Basin Reserve, Wellington.

The Kings have dominated this matchup, winning the last four encounters, including both games this season. This psychological edge, along with their balanced squad, makes them the favorites heading into this high-stakes clash. Meanwhile, Northern Brave have struggled in the second half of the season, and they must put in a strong performance to overcome their losing streak and secure a spot in the final.

Team Previews

Northern Brave Preview

Jeet Raval’s Northern Brave had a successful league stage, finishing second on the points table. However, they would have preferred more match practice before this crucial game, as their last match against Wellington Firebirds was washed out. Their recent four-match losing streak against Canterbury Kings will be a concern, and Raval’s squad must find a way to turn things around.

Batting concerns remain a major issue. Katene Clarke, the team’s leading run-scorer, needs to give them a strong start alongside Joe Carter. However, the middle order has struggled, and the team will need big performances from Robert O’Donnell, Ben Pomare, and Mitchell Santner to build partnerships. The lower middle order, consisting of Jeet Raval and Brett Hampton, will also have a crucial role to play.

The bowling attack faces a tough challenge against Canterbury’s formidable batting lineup. Kristian Clarke and Matthew Fisher must deliver early breakthroughs, while experienced pacers Neil Wagner and Mitchell Santner must dominate the middle overs. Frederick Walker and Hampton will provide support, but overall, Northern Brave’s bowling unit must step up under pressure.

Key Players: Katene Clarke, Mitchell Santner, Neil Wagner

Canterbury Kings Preview

Canterbury Kings enter this match full of confidence, having beaten Northern Brave convincingly by 56 runs in their last game. With a strong batting lineup and a well-rounded bowling attack, they will be eager to continue their dominance over Brave and book their place in the final.

Opener Chad Bowes has been rock-solid, providing consistent starts alongside the experienced Tom Latham. The middle order is the Kings’ biggest strength, with Matthew Boyle, their leading run-scorer, supported by Daryl Mitchell and skipper Cole McConchie. The lower order, featuring Mitchell Hay, Kyle Jamieson, and Zakary Foulkes, adds depth and power.

Their bowling attack is equally dangerous. Matt Henry and Kyle Jamieson are capable of dismantling any top order with their pace and movement. Zakary Foulkes and William O’Rourke provide control in the middle overs, while Ish Sodhi and McConchie add variety with their spin. With their bowlers in top form, the Kings look well-balanced for this crucial encounter.

Key Players: Daryl Mitchell, Matthew Boyle, Kyle Jamieson

Pitch Report & Weather Conditions

Weather Conditions

The Wellington weather is expected to be overcast with slight drizzle. The conditions will be challenging for batsmen, and fast bowlers will enjoy movement off the pitch.

Pitch Report

The Basin Reserve surface assists fast bowlers, but it remains a good batting pitch once the ball settles down.

  • Average First Innings Score: 161 runs (last two years)
  • Highest Total at Venue (2024-25 Season): 180+ is a strong target
  • Best Strategy: The team batting first should aim for at least 180 runs to stay competitive.

Toss Prediction: To Bowl First

The last three games at Basin Reserve have been won by teams batting first, but the underlying moisture makes batting tricky early on. The team winning the toss might opt to bowl first to take advantage of the conditions.

Winning Prediction

Northern Brave have been a strong team this season, but their poor record against Canterbury Kings will be weighing heavily on their minds. They are up against the strongest batting lineup of the season, and their bowlers must deliver a special performance to turn things around.

However, Canterbury Kings have a balanced team, match-winners in both departments, and a winning streak against Northern Brave. Given their recent dominance in head-to-head contests, the Kings are the favorites to win this match and progress to the final.

Prediction: Canterbury Kings to win the Eliminator Final.
